Description:
Jorge Ubico y Castañeda was President of Guatemala from 14 February, 1931 to 4 July, 1944. Ubico is widely considered the last of the Liberal authoritarian rulers in Latin America. Born to Arturo Ubico Urruela, a lawyer and politician of the Guatemalan liberal party, Jorge Ubico was sheltered for most of his childhood. Wikipedia
